ILOSTAT - Labour force survey — Employment by age, total (15+), rural in Namibia
Namibia: ILOSTAT - Labour force survey — Employment by age, total (15+), rural was 158.39 1000 No in 2018. ▬ Flat
ILOSTAT - Labour force survey — Employment by age, total (15+), rural in Namibia, 2012–2018
Source: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ations. Measured in 1000 No.
Analysis
In 2018, ilostat - labour force survey — employment by age, total (15+), rural in Namibia stood at 158.39 1000 No.
That represents a change of up 28.1% on the previous year and up 15.1% over ten years.
That places Namibia 66th out of 80 countries with data for 2018, putting it in the bottom quarter.

About this data
The FAOSTAT Employment indicators domain focuses on indicators related to employment in agrifood systems and rural areas. The update is performed yearly, using data from the International Labour Organization (ILO) database that contains a rich set of indicators from a wide range of topics related to labour statistics. The indicators published in FAOSTAT are derived from the labour force statistics (LFS) and rural and urban labour markets (RURURB) databases of the ILOSTAT database.
